What kind of events happen on the Mount Vernon Campus?
There is a wide range of activities to participate in at Mount Vernon. Here is a sampling of past, and future campus activities: Coffeehouses, film series, Wacky Wednesdays, Halloween parties and hall decorating contests, comedy nights, Welcome Week events, outdoor movies, events for African American History and Women’s History months, karaoke, oscar parties, kukuwa dance workouts, yoga sessions, catholic masses and much more. The Mount Vernon Programming Council, House Proctors, Academic Mentors and Hall Councils are some of the student groups that plan activities at Mount Vernon. Students are always welcome to propose new events, and the Mount Vernon Programming Council can provide co-sponsorship money in some cases.
